GENERAL SUMMARY:
Under the direction of the Sergeants/Department head, dispatchers are a point of contact via phone, radio, and person, providing assistance and/or direction to those needing help or information. Disseminates information between Tribal Enforcement and other agencies (Sheriff, CHP, and Fire Dept.) during a crisis situation. The Barona Tribal Enforcement Unit provides patrol services to all Tribal lands except for the Casino, Golf Course, and Casino Parking Lots.

GENERAL SUMMARY:
Under supervision, responds to fire alarms, medical emergencies, hazardous condition situations, public incidents, and other types of emergencies. Protects life and property endangered by fire and other emergencies; performs fire safety inspections, and performs related duties as required. Positions in this class are primarily responsible for the operations of a fire hose and related equipment when engaged in fire suppression and the administration of first aid when engaged in medical calls.

GENERAL SUMMARY: The goal of the Barona Tribal Enforcement Unit is to provide a safe and secure quality of life to the members of the Barona Band of Mission Indians and their guests. We provide patrol services to all Tribal Lands except for the Casino, Golf Course, and Casino Parking Lots. BTE utilizes a combination of vehicle patrol and other means of patrol in order to make ourselves highly visible on the reservation.
